Not as many personal details are known about Kenny Hickey, guitarist of Type O Negative, as, for example, about Peter Steele. But from the recollections of colleagues, interviews and rare notes, one can gather a general impression of his character: Quiet and reserved - unlike the charismatic and eccentric Peter Steele, Kenny often remained "in the shadows", did not like to be in the spotlight and focused more on music. Dark Humor - Like all members of Type O Negative, he had a signature sarcasm and irony that was part of the band's style. Loyal and dedicated - Kenny was with the band from the beginning and stayed until the end, which speaks volumes about his loyalty and dedication to the cause. Creative and sensitive, in addition to the guitar, he wrote music and later created the projects Seventh Void and Silvertomb, which shows his desire for self-expression. Stavrogin is a young man of 28, tall and strong physically, beautifully dressed, with the manners of a socialite. The only son of Varvara Petrovna Stavrogina. He is not very talkative, elegant without refinement, surprisingly modest and at the same time bold and self-confident as a nobody. Outwardly, he is very handsome: black hair, light clear and calm eyes, delicate, even pale, complexion, bright blush and pinkish lips. He often carries a metal cane with him. Stavrogin concentrates all the trademark traits and shortcomings of "superfluous people": self-centeredness, indifference to moral issues, atheism. Stavrogin walled himself up in intellectualism. Even sensuality for him is only entertainment, a toy. He seduced a 14-year-old girl. Meanwhile, Stavrogin is accompanied by constant melancholy, sadness as, perhaps, a premonition of his doom. He's cold and cruel. Playfully, he can inspire anyone completely opposite feelings and ideas, because he has none of his own, but the overbearing charm, charisma - a lot. The boredom of mental desolation - the main feature of his nature. Probably schizophrenic. He is acquainted with Pyotr Stepanovich Verkhovensky, a lying manipulator, a sycophant, ready to do anything for the sake of his revolutionary idea, completely devoid of moral principles. He sows chaos to corrupt society only because of the same idea. Probably a sociopath. Stavrogin also knows Ivan Pavlovich Shatov, a former student and participant in the revolutionary organization. He had been a member of Pyotr Stepanovich's society under the old organization, when he himself was fascinated by the ideas of socialism. After a trip to America, he drastically changed his views because of Stavrogin's influence on him. Nikolai Stavrogin treats Kirillov with obvious sympathy and is much friendlier than with Shatov. He and Kirillov have known each other for a very long time, since the time of St. Petersburg, and even earlier.
The action takes place in a provincial town in the second half of the 19th century, with the estates of the nobility, officialdom and revolutionary youth. It is located somewhere between Moscow and St. Petersburg. Nikolai Stavrogin has returned from his 4-year journey through Europe. He begins to behave mysteriously and provocatively. He pulls a whole series of scandalous pranks. Insults people, for example, he publicly bites the ear of Governor von Lembke and publicly insults the general. He enters into a secret sham marriage, namely marries an unhappy girl Marya Lebyadkina, but then leaves her to live in poverty with a cruel brother who beats her. He supports the revolutionaries, although he himself is indifferent to their ideas, his image and behavior inspire the radicals.
